# Basic Information

#### Server Settings

* Max Base Level: **255**
* Max Job Level: **120**
* Max Stats: **255**
* Max ASPD: **196**
* Instant Cast: **150 DEX**
* Pre-Renewal Mechanics
* Android Mobile Client
* Gepard Shield Protection
* Guild Capacity: **20 Members**

#### Rates

* Base EXP: **5,000x**
* Job EXP: **5,000x**
* Normal Cards: **3%**
* MVP Cards: **1.5%**
* Rare Cards: **0.1% – 1%**
